Compared with the surrounding streets, this postcode does not stand out as either a particular hotspot or an unusually safe pocket. Crime levels in the neighbouring output areas are broadly in line with this area.
The overall crime rate in the area around Back Lane (LN4 2EJ) in the last 12 months was 37.6 per 1,000 residents and was 23.2% lower than the Branston average (49.0 per 1,000 residents). In the last 12 months, this area’s most reported crimes were Violence and sexual offences with 6 offences recorded. The least common crime was Anti-social behaviour with 1 case , down -66.7% compared to 2024. The fastest-growing crime category was Bicycle theft ( 100.0% YoY). The sharpest decline was Anti-social behaviour ( -66.7% YoY).
Violent crimes totalled 7 (≈ 18.8 per 1,000 residents). Year-over-year these were rising ( 16.7% ). Over the last decade, overall crime has rising ( 103.8% comparing early vs recent averages) .
In the area around Back Lane (LN4 2EJ), the highest concentration of overall crime is near Willow Lane, where police recorded 5 incidents. Violent and public-order offences occur most often near Halls Court (3 offences). Both locations lie within roughly 0.3 miles of this postcode area.
